Using the Mapon API and the Google Maps API, the map must show the route taken by the car. The user must be able to select a car from the list of available cars and the time period (days). After confirming the selected car and period, a map with the route must be displayed.
To get a local copy up and running follow these steps:
- Clone the repo
git clone https://github.com/francoromanol/mapon-frontend.git
- Install NPM packages
yarn install
- Create
.env.local
file and fill the variables:REACT_APP_MAPON_URL= [mapon base url] REACT_APP_MAPON_API_KEY= [mapon api key] REACT_APP_MAPS_API_KEY= [google maps api key]
-
yarn start
